Full Biography

The Premonitions are an indie pop rock band that play together regularly that comes in both a 3 and 4 piece line-up, and are totally devoted to provide the best performances around easily providing the best in event entertainment no matter what your venue, be it Club, pub, Marquee or stately home.Their experience playing together means you can expect a tight performance that will get and keep the numbers on the dancefloor from the get-go. 

The band is led by Laurent, and have been performing together since 2017, rocking stages, barns, tipis, hotels, marquees, castles, caves, beaches, pubs patios, kitchens and back gardens! As well as performing at events, and for studio sessions for well-known radio DJs and original artists’ day in day out. All of the supporting band members are also full time musicians who teach, perform for a living and session on recordings. Collectively the band has studied at the prestigious British Institute of Modern Music (BIMM) at the London Centre of Contemporary Music. Laurent is backed by Paolo on guitar and backing vocals Ewan on bass and backing vocals, and Thomas on drums and backing vocals. The band is proud to be part of a high-calibre collective of musicians that are some of the most in-demand talent in the UK music industry. The members have also had the honour of supporting Culture Club, City, London Heaven, Crucible Theatre, Manchester Gorilla, Scarborough Nile Rodgers, Boy George & Chic; performed with Jax Jones, Demi Lovato, Gizmo Varillas, Emeli Sande, Trevor Nelson, and multiple X-Factor and The Voice finalists; worked with Dan Gillespie-Sells of The Feeling; and been part of the original production of Everybody’s Talking About Jamie. Band members have also gone viral with a cover of Wonderwall, landing them on, BBC News, Good Morning Britain and CBBC Saturday Mashup Live. You might have even seen these lads playing at numerous O2s arenas, the 100 club, The Jazz Cafe, Nottingham Rock Open Air Theatre and Ronnie Scott’s Jazz Club.
